The image displays the interior of a severely damaged, multi-story concrete structure located in Joubar Municipality, Syria. The scene is characterized by extensive structural degradation, with a thick layer of rubble, concrete fragments, and dust covering the ground. On the left, a partially destroyed concrete staircase ascends, revealing a dark void or opening beneath its lower steps. The adjacent walls are heavily damaged, with sections of plaster missing and exposing concrete and underlying masonry. To the right, a dark doorway leads into an obscured interior space. In front of this doorway, a substantial accumulation of debris, including concrete chunks and scattered pieces of white paper, lies on the floor. A prominent vertical concrete pillar or wall section stands centrally, separating the left and right areas of the visible space. Overhead, the ceilings and undersides of upper floor sections are severely compromised, showing exposed rebar and damaged concrete slabs. No individuals, discernable actions, or interactive elements are present within the frame.
